Veritone Earnings Call Used Synthetic Voices

Article Featured Image

Veritone's fourth quarter and full year 2021 financial results call featured digitally cloned voices of CEO Chad Steelberg, President Ryan Steelberg, Chief Financial Officer Mike Zemetra, and legendary sports announcer Vin Scully. It was reportedly the world's first use of multilingual synthetic voice clones for a financial results call.

"I have yet to meet an executive who enjoys reading scripts developed by marketing, altered by investor relations, and scrutinized by legal, into a microphone, even when i's great news," Ryan Steelberg said in a statement. "Executives are also often fatigued in the preparation for earnings, but with Veritone Voice are now able to express the vocal tone they prefer when delivering the script. Furthermore, the speed and quality of the synthetic content we can produce has changed the way broadcasters, podcasters, audiobook publishers, and animation studios are producing content. The two largest broadcasters in the U.S. are now leveraging our solution for content creation and localization. Once enterprises realize how much content they produce and how efficient realistic synthetic content creation and localization is, they, too, will follow the path of the media and entertainment industry."

With Veritone's Voice-as-a-Service (VaaS) solutions, Veritone offers a suite of integrated voice features, including voice creation, voice management, voice licensing with rights and clearances, voice workflows, and voice monetization. Veritone Voice enables users to create synthetic custom voices and create projects with stock voices from a library of more than 200 voices across more than 150 languages. It supports both text-to-speech and speech-to-speech.

"Getting earnings data out into the market is incredibly important and often stressful as we scrutinize every detail in our script and filings," Zemetra said in a statement. "When using synthetic voice for our financial results call, my first concern was what if there are last-minute changes or corrections? I discovered that Veritone Voice takes just a few minutes with updates, and it also enhances non-verbal aspects of speech, such as pitch, volume, speed of delivery, rhythm, and intonation, making my synthetic voice the closest version of my own voice."

"Every large enterprise executive should have their voice cloned in 2022," said Scott Leatherman, chief marketing officer of Veritone, in a statement. "Beyond the basic earnings call script, enterprise leadership can use their authorized voice models for solution demos, marketing videos, and established Title II and Title III regulations for audio descriptions. With Veritone Voice, executives can engage their audiences with audio files they can listen to anywhere, in the language of their choice, at a fraction of the cost and time it takes in traditional content development with the immediate transfer of credibility from the company's top executives."
